Hong Kong (Chinese: ??) is a special administrative region (SAR) of
the People’s Republic of China (PRC). It is situated on China’s south
coast and, enclosed by the Pearl River Delta and South China Sea,it is
known for its expansive skyline and deep natural harbor. With a land
mass of 1,104 km2 (426 sq mi) and a population of seven million people,
Hong Kong is one of the most densely populated areas in the world. Hong
Kong’s population is 95 percent ethnic Chinese and 5 percent from other
groups. Hong Kong’s Han Chinese majority originate mainly from the
cities of Guangzhou and Taishan in the neighboring Guangdong province.
Under the principle of “one country, two systems”, Hong Kong has a
different political system from mainland China.Hong Kong’s independent
judiciary functions under the common law framework. Hong Kong Basic Law,
its constitutional document, which stipulates that Hong Kong shall have
a “high degree of autonomy” in all matters except foreign relations and
military defense, governs its political system. Although it has a
burgeoning multi-party system, a small-circle electorate controls half
of its legislature. That is, the Chief Executive of Hong Kong, the head
of government, is chosen by an Election Committee of 400 to 1,200
members, a situation that will be in effect during the first 20 years of
Chinese rule.
As one of the world’s leading international financial centers, Hong
Kong has a major capitalist service economy characterized by low
taxation and free trade, and the currency, Hong Kong dollar, is the
eighth most traded currency in the world
